This document is an email chain from June to August 2019 involving a Forensic Psychologist at the MCC New York (Federal Bureau of Prisons). The psychologist details severe understaffing in the department and a personal medical procedure as reasons for requesting a 15-day extension to complete a forensic evaluation (likely for Jeffrey Epstein, given the attachment filename '70497-050_ORD.pdf', which matches his inmate number). The correspondence includes references to a letter sent to a Judge signed by the Warden.

This document is an email thread from August 13, 2019, originating from freelance journalist Beth Shelburne. She contacted a Bureau of Prisons facility (likely MCC New York, indicated by 'NYM') to request current staffing levels for a story on prison suicides following the Jeffrey Epstein case. The email was then forwarded by the Executive Assistant at the facility to a redacted recipient.

An email chain from August 12, 2019 (two days after Epstein's death), in which an Executive Assistant forwards a request for information regarding Jeffrey Epstein. The original request was sent by a Certified Law Enforcement Analyst from the Florida Department of Law Enforcement (FORTS Registration Compliance Unit) following a phone conversation.

This document is an email forwarding a letter written to Jeffrey Epstein while he was incarcerated at MCC New York in July 2019. The sender, an academic claiming credentials from Oxford and Harvard, proposes a 'quid pro quo' arrangement: if Epstein donates $5 million to Morgan State University or funds the sender personally, the sender promises to publicly defend Epstein, generate positive media coverage, and help him avoid a conviction 'like Bill Cosby.' The sender leverages their academic standing and potential position at Oxford as a means to rehabilitate Epstein's public image.
